Privacy as a Privilege: An Intersectional Perspective on Street Harassment – FEM Newsmagazine: "Intersectional feminism accounts for the spectrum of experiences for women of differing demographics. For example, the experiences of women differ depending their race, ability, and sexuality, amongst other factors. In the case of street harassment, low-income women endure harassment disproportionately to women of higher income."
